The HVAC market in Redstone, Montana, is heavily influenced by its semi-arid continental climate, characterized by long, bitterly cold winters with temperatures often plunging below zero and short, warm summers. This creates extreme seasonal demand, with a primary focus on reliable and robust heating system installation, service, and emergency repairs. Furnaces and boilers are the most critical systems, though air conditioning maintenance and installation have grown in importance. The top contractors distinguish themselves through 24/7 emergency availability, expertise in high-efficiency heating technology suited for cold climates, and a strong reputation for reliability within the small, tight-knit community.
